Definition of RAGWORT

ragwort

Meanings

Plural: ragworts

Noun

  • widespread European weed having yellow daisylike flowers; sometimes an obnoxious weed and toxic to cattle if consumed in quantity
  • American ragwort with yellow flowers
  • Any of a number of wild flowering plants with yellow flowers in the family Asteraceae, mostly belonging to Senecio and related genera.

Origin / Etymology

From rag (referring to the ragged leaves) + wort.

Synonyms

benweed, butterweed, ragweed, Senecio glabellus, Senecio jacobaea, tansy ragwort
